Take a ride on the breathtaking Seattle Great Wheel on Pier 57 and see the city of Seattle like never ever before as you skyrocket 175 feet over the water. (Inside tip: Browse through at sundown to catch the sunlight dip behind the Olympic Mountains in a radiant blaze of color.)Saturate in scenic views of the Emerald green City from the top of the Great Wheel.


Clear days also compensate you with a magnificent view of Mount Rainier! If you love sandy coastlines, seaside sunsets and bbq pits (and who doesn't?) Golden Gardens Park has obtained all packages inspected. Head to the coastline and join a perky game of volleyball or stroll to the north nature preserve and attempt to find the neighborhood turtles.


In the summer, cool down off with a dip at the coastline, then wander the surrounding area stores, restaurants, and bars.
